Street Summary

York Rd, Bondi Junction NSW 2022 is a collector road with a 50km/h speed limit. 12 homes sit level with the street. 12 homes are heritage-listed and 2 are recommended for a flood check. The street is 46% houses and 53.8% apartments. Notable developments include 27 York Rd (6 lots, 4 levels, built 1971) and 1 York Rd (3 lots, 2 levels, built 1981). Is York Rd an expensive or affordable street relative to Bondi Junction?

There are insufficient recent house sales on York Rd to calculate a reliable premium or discount against the Bondi Junction average, so buyers should compare recent sales of individual homes on the street against nearby comparable properties to gauge current market positioning.

What are the risk and overlay factors on York Rd?

There are no bushfire, flood overlay, or high-voltage powerline risks on York Rd. Twelve properties are heritage-listed, meaning renovations or exterior changes may require additional council approval. Two homes are recommended for a flood check, while 10 properties have been reviewed and found to have no flood risk identified or not mapped.

Are properties on York Rd mostly on high, level or low ground?

12 homes sit level with the street. Different site heights relative to the street can influence site characteristics, so buyers should assess the specific property rather than relying on the street average.

What type of road is York Rd?

York Rd is a collector road with a 50 km/h speed limit, and 100% of the residential properties front this section. Collector roads generally connect local streets with larger roads, which may mean slightly more through traffic than a local street.

Is York Rd mostly houses or apartments?

York Rd has 26 residential properties, with 46.2% being houses and 53.8% being apartments. The street has a mixed profile of dwelling types, with neither category clearly representing the majority of the residential stock.

What are the major apartment developments on York Rd?

The major apartment developments on York Rd are 27 York Rd, a 4-level building with 6 lots built in 1971, and 1 York Rd, a 2-level building with 3 lots built in 1981. These developments contribute to the street's higher-density residential character.

How many properties have sold on York Rd?

One house and one apartment have sold on York Rd in the past 12 months. The 5-year turnover rate is 16.7% for houses and 14.3% for apartments, representing the proportion of properties that changed ownership during the past five years.
